USMT and K2

Has anybody successfully implemented a system to have the K2 use the USMT to capture and deploy user states? My testing has indicated that for it to work in Windows 7 you must turn UAC off. I am curious if anybody is using this feature, and if it does indeed necessitate turning UAC off, or is there some way to get around it.

A related question is: Where does the K2 keep the config files for the USMT Templates? I would like to generate a template and then use that to script out User State capture by some other methods.

If you want to create a new config file you can use the following tool:

USMT XML Builder

It is availble at the following site: http://www.wintools.com.au/ and it is a 30 days trial!

This tools allows you to create the application and user xml, you will need then, via commandline, to create the config.xml file which you will be then able to upload into the K1000. Go to: http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/dd560755(v=ws.10).aspx  to get more information.

I found a config.xml at \\K2000\USMT\bin\usmt4\x86. It matches the template I want to use. My intention is to use this config file to script out an online state capture mechanism.
